Today we await the arrival of the Minister of Education who is visiting us as part of the consultation process for the Greater Chirstchurch Education Renewal Plan. We continue to be bewildered as to why we have been included within the scope of this plan given our growing roll, our location on the West of Christchurch and the subdivisions in close proximity to our school. We serve the families of the children who choose to come to us very well and would like to continue the good work we do.

Winter Fun Day an Icy and Snowy Success!
Whether our students were at Alpine Skating Centre or Mt Hutt Ski Resort they had a fabulous time yesterday. The weather and conditions on Mt Hutt were close to perfect and many of our students had progressed by lunchtime to riding the Quad Chairlift. Others had a great day learning the basics on the Magic Carpet Beginners Slope.
Likewise our students had great fun at the Alpine Ice Skating Rink. For many of our students it was their first time on skates and they did very well.
Today the school is buzzing with stories of fast skating and super skiing. It is always great to have a change of learning environment.
Thank you to all parents/caregivers for your wonderful support.

A Super Duathlon
Every child at Yaldhurst Model School took part in our duathlon. It was to be a triathlon but the cold weather of late has meant that we closed the school pool. Changing from three to two events simply meant that everyone was able to put even more effort into running and cycling. The looks of determination showed that everyone was giving 100% + effort!
It was very pleasing to have great family support. Our duathlon was a great success and we hope that next year we are back to having a triathlon.
